Peter Gray graduated from Columbia magna cum laude and Phi Beta Kappa with a degree with Psychology. Later, he went off to get a Ph.D. in Biology downtown at Rockefeller University, became a professor at Boston College, and wrote a popular Psychology textbook which most introductory students use to this day.
